Benefits of Tofu Fried Low Calorie

Tofu fried low calorie offers numerous benefits, making it an attractive option for those looking to manage their weight or adopt a healthier lifestyle. Some of the key benefits include:

  • Low in calories: Tofu is naturally low in calories, with a 3-ounce serving containing approximately 80 calories. When prepared using low-calorie cooking methods, tofu can be an excellent addition to a weight loss diet.
  • High in protein: Tofu is an excellent source of protein, making it an ideal option for vegetarians and vegans. A 3-ounce serving of tofu contains around 9 grams of protein.
  • Rich in iron and calcium: Tofu is a good source of iron and calcium, essential minerals for maintaining healthy red blood cells and strong bones.

Preparation Methods

There are several ways to prepare tofu fried low calorie, each with its unique characteristics and benefits. Some popular methods include:

  1. Air frying: Air frying uses little to no oil, making it an excellent option for those looking to reduce their calorie intake. This method also helps retain the nutrients in the tofu.
  2. Baking: Baking is another low-calorie cooking method that uses dry heat to cook the tofu. This method is ideal for those who want to avoid added oils.
  3. Pan-frying with minimal oil: Pan-frying with minimal oil is a great way to achieve the crispy texture of fried food while keeping calorie intake in check. Using a small amount of oil, such as olive oil or avocado oil, can help add flavor without excessive calories.
Cooking MethodCalories per serving
Air frying120-150 calories
Baking100-120 calories
Pan-frying with minimal oil150-200 calories
💡 To achieve the perfect crispy texture when pan-frying tofu, make sure to press the tofu before cooking to remove excess moisture. This step will help the tofu brown more evenly and prevent it from becoming soggy.

What is the best way to press tofu for pan-frying?

+

To press tofu, wrap it in a clean kitchen towel or paper towels and place it between two plates. Weigh down the top plate with a heavy object, such as a cast-iron skillet, for at least 30 minutes to remove excess moisture.

Can I use any type of oil for pan-frying tofu?

+

No, not all oils are suitable for pan-frying tofu. Choose oils with a high smoke point, such as avocado oil or grapeseed oil, to prevent the oil from burning or smoking during cooking.
